Elegant sapphire and diamond cufflinks in the
classic "night and day" style (see below) of the early 20th
century. One side is set with a rich blue sapphire and the
other with a sparkling diamond. The platinum tops are
engraved with fine pinstripes surrounded by classic Art Deco
borders. Created by Carrington & Company in 14kt gold
and platinum, circa 1925.
![]() The backs of the cufflinks are finely crafted in 14kt gold. Carrington & Company's attention to small details can be seen in the strong cross bars and study raised brackets that secure the cufflinks on the cuff as well as protect the gemstones. Beneath the brackets the backs are stamped "GOLD & PLAT" for the precious metals.
![]() The tops of the cross bars are stamped with the maker's mark of Carrington & Company, a "C" surrounding "14". Carrington was a maker of fine cufflinks and dress sets from 1900 to about 1950. Sapphire and diamond cufflinks, sometimes known
as "night and day" cufflinks, were a reflection of
the late Victorian belief that diamonds should only be worn
after dark. In theory, a gentleman would wear these
cufflinks with the sapphires facing outward during the day and
in the evening reverse the cufflinks to display the
diamonds. In practice, personal taste and circumstance
most likely decided whether the diamonds or the sapphires were
displayed on the outer cuffs.
